Towing service, automotive, Towing bars and systems
Jackson's Wrecker Service
Jackson's Wrecker Service is a reputable towing company based in Landrum, SC, offering reliable vehicle recovery and transportation services to the local community. With a team of experienced professionals and a fleet of well-maintained tow trucks, Jackson's Wrecker Service provides prompt and efficient assistance for roadside emergencies and vehicle removal needs.
Generated from their business information